Transaction 27637d1dd442133864ca5bde014c752f042fcc18239e823330b0364f72597726

2 Input
2 Outputs
  • 27637d1dd442133864ca5bde014c752f042fcc18239e823330b0364f72597726:0
  • value  2954261
    address  3Ax1eRRhAuFBfJSMdeSkzmLjfP6egbJTTm
  • 27637d1dd442133864ca5bde014c752f042fcc18239e823330b0364f72597726:1
  • value  989017
    address  3EsuoEMzCSiyRnug188h9s3h4NupxhT36o